THE CURE CANCER AUSTRALIA FOUNDATION, FORMERLY THE LEO & JENNY LEUKAEMIA
AND CANCER: YOUNG RESEARCHER OF THE YEAR AWARD
The Foundation has supported research into malignant disease for over 30
years. In recognition of the exceptional abilities of emerging research
talent, the Foundation presents the prestigious annual Award to the value
of $5,000 cash. Presentation of the Award will be during the Young
Researcher Dinner on Monday 12 May 2003 at Parliament House.

NATIONAL HEALTH AND MEDICAL RESEARCH COUNCIL:
AWARD FOR EXCELLENCE IN HEALTH AND MEDICAL RESEARCH
The NHMRC is offering an annual Award open to researchers who have
completed a PhD within the last 15 years. The Award, made in recognition of
outstanding individual achievement in health and medical research in
Australia, is now in its fourth year and consists of $50,000 and a
presentation medal.

MS AUSTRALIA PROJECT GRANTS AND SEEDING GRANTS
Project grants are MSA's main avenue for the support of research relevant
to multiple sclerosis. Applications are invited to submit for small grants
($5,000 for one year only) to 'seed' the earliest stages of new research
efforts. Please note, for all applications, the deadline for ethics
approval is 31 August 2003.

TELSTRA FOUNDATION CO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T FUND
The Community Development Fund supports charitable organizations that
assist or support Australian children and young people. Projects should
focus on benefiting children and young people who are 18 years and
under. Project topic suggestions can be found on the Telstra website.

NATIONAL HEART FOUNDATION RESEARCH FELLOWSHIPS
The Foundation offers Postdoctoral Fellowships, Overseas Research
Fellowships, and Career Development Fellowships to graduates of recognised
institutions whose usual place of residence is in Australia and who propose
to engage in basic, clinical and public health research related to CVD and
